Many times car accidents are difficult to avoid. Below are some helpful tips that might help decrease injuries.

According to the Spine Research Institute of San Diego, over 45% of people with chronic neck pain attribute there condition to a past car accident. Headrests are designed to reduce the effects of whiplash injury to the neck if they are adjusted properly. Headrests prevent the head from going over the back of the car seat. However, if the headrest is low it will not prevent the head from going backward. The headrest should be adjusted so that the top of the head is even with the top of the headrest. It is also beneficial if the headrest can be adjusted forward to decrease the distance between the head and the headrest.
